Your role
As Risk & Regulatory Consultant, you’ll oversee a broad spectrum of risk management topics in this 1st Line Non-Financial Risk role – from strategic design to day-to-day execution. You’ll act as a bridge between the business and second-line risk management, ensuring regulatory expectations are met in an innovative and scalable way.
Your key responsibilities include:
Designing and maintaining a fit-for-purpose risk control framework, including defining risk appetite and monitoring through key risk indicators (KRIs), together with the team
Translating (new) regulations into smart, agile implementation strategies that balance innovation and compliance
Advising product teams on risks and opportunities, and supporting strategic decision-making
Promoting a strong risk culture by organizing workshops, awareness sessions and knowledge sharing across teams
Leading incident coordination and crisis management, ensuring clear communication and timely solution
